To calculate the outer dimensions of the area, including the border, you need to add the width of the border on all sides to the inner dimensions.

Given:
Inner length = 100 m
Inner breadth = 50 m
Width of the border = 2 m

Step 1: Calculate the outer length:
Outer length = Inner length + 2 * Width of the border
Outer length = 100 m + 2 * 2 m
Outer length = 100 m + 4 m
Outer length = 104 m

Step 2: Calculate the outer breadth:
Outer breadth = Inner breadth + 2 * Width of the border
Outer breadth = 50 m + 2 * 2 m
Outer breadth = 50 m + 4 m
Outer breadth = 54 m

Therefore, the outer dimensions of the area, including the border, are:
Outer length = 104 m
Outer breadth = 54 m
